Eight wards of Chandragiri Municipality declared child labor free



KATHMANDU: Chandragiri municipality has been declaring its wards child-labor-free by setting a campaign and realizing the goal within the current fiscal year.

In this connection, ward no 10 of the municipality was declared a child labour-free ward today.

Declaring ward no 10 as the child-labor-free ward at a program organized here today, Mayor Ghan Shyam Gri said the municipality had given high priority to end exploitation of children and activities should be carried out for the sustainability after the declaration.

Ward no 3, ward no 5, ward no 6, ward no 7, ward no 8, ward no 11 and ward no 14 of Chandragiri municipality have already been declared free of child labour.
